Output 81aae7314d315df4137dcdcd0c25089aae05fd27467934021ae87550ea271c32:0
- value
- 26739007
- script pubkey
- OP_0 OP_PUSHBYTES_20 babf5f4dae38d362f4200fbc7b7c7dbc6b42f7ec
- address
- bc1qh2l47ndw8rfk9apqp778klrah3459alvjpfvdt
- transaction
- 81aae7314d315df4137dcdcd0c25089aae05fd27467934021ae87550ea271c32